Asst. Professor - Medicine teaches courses in the discipline area of medicine. Develops and designs curriculum plans to foster student learning, stimulate class discussions, and ensures student engagement. Being an Asst. Professor - Medicine provides tutoring and academic counseling to students, maintains classes related records, and assesses student coursework. Collaborates and supports colleagues regarding research interests and co-curricular activities. Additionally, Asst. Professor - Medicine typically reports to a department head. Requires a PhD or terminal degree appropriate to the field. Has experience and is qualified to teach at undergraduate and graduate levels and contributes to research In a specialized field.     This position is for an experienced research coordinator who will support research efforts related to the Outcomes Registry for Cardiac Conditions in Athletes (ORCCA). The ORCCA project is a collaborative multi-site registry to monitor cardiovascular, mental health, and quality of life outcomes in athletes with heart conditions at risk for sudden cardiac arrest. This position will include leadership of elements of the research process and supervision of other research staff. The research coordinator will work directly with three principal investigators.

Seattle (/siˈætəl/ (listen) see-AT-əl) is a seaport city on the West Coast of the United States. It is the seat of King County, Washington. With an estimated 730,000 residents as of 2018[update], Seattle is the largest city in both the state of Washington and the Pacific Northwest region of North America. According to U.S. Census data released in 2018, the Seattle metropolitan area’s population stands at 3.87 million, and ranks as the 15th largest in the United States.
